help! i've been trying to discover who sings a couple of ballads that i've heard occasionally on radio but can never catch his name. I think one is call Bees' Wing. the other i think is called Vincent Black Lightening 1942. They both sound like it's the same singer, but i can't be certain.... thanks for any help!

Hi - both songs were recorded by Richard Thompson. Click here to get to a site with lots of Richard Thompson lyircs, but I don't know if it has the songs you're seeking.

Greg Brown does a version of "1952 Vincent Black Lightning" on his 1995 "Live One" recording.

Dick Gaughan does an extremely emotional and fantastic version of 1952 Vincent Black Lightning on his Appleseed cd "Sail On".
